Anyway, Mario Chalmers will be back on the Heat, as the Sun-Sentinel reports: “Point guard Mario Chalmers has become the third Miami Heat player secured on the books for 2010-11. While neither side would confirm the formal paperwork has been completed, the Sun Sentinel has learned that the Heat has informed Chalmers that it will pick up the option year on his rookie contract. The Heat had until June 24, the day of the NBA Draft, to make its decision. Chalmers now joins forward Michael Beasley and guard Daequan Cook as the only Heat players locked into 2010-11 salaries.”
